然而,在使用VMware虚拟机(VM)的过程中,由于误操作、系统故障或存储问题等原因,虚拟机被意外删除的情况时有发生
这不仅可能导致重要数据的丢失,还可能对业务连续性造成严重影响
因此,掌握VMware虚拟机删除恢复的技术和方法,对于保障数据安全和业务稳定运行至关重要
一、虚拟机删除恢复的重要性 虚拟机删除可能带来一系列连锁反应,包括但不限于: - 数据丢失:虚拟机中存储的应用数据、配置文件、用户资料等可能无法找回
- 业务中断:关键业务应用运行在被删除的虚拟机上,恢复不及时将导致服务中断
- 成本增加:数据恢复服务、重建虚拟机及重新安装软件等都会带来额外的成本开销
- 信誉损害:对于依赖在线服务的企业而言,长时间的服务不可用可能损害客户信任
因此,及时有效地恢复被删除的虚拟机,对于减少损失、维护业务连续性具有不可替代的作用
二、VMware虚拟机删除的常见原因 了解虚拟机删除的常见原因,有助于我们采取预防措施,降低意外发生的概率
这些原因包括但不限于: 1.人为误操作:管理员或用户在执行删除、迁移或备份操作时,不慎选中了错误的虚拟机
2.存储故障:存储介质损坏、文件系统错误或存储阵列故障导致虚拟机文件丢失
3.软件故障:VMware ESXi或vCenter Server软件bug、升级失败或配置错误
4.病毒攻击:恶意软件破坏或删除虚拟机文件
5.自然灾害:火灾、洪水等自然灾害导致的物理硬件损坏
三、虚拟机删除前的预防措施 虽然无法完全避免虚拟机删除事件的发生,但采取以下预防措施可以大大降低风险: - 定期备份:利用VMware的备份解决方案(如Veeam、VMware Data Protection等)定期备份虚拟机,确保有可用的恢复点
- 权限管理:严格控制对VMware环境的访问权限,避免非授权操作
- 监控与报警:部署监控系统,实时监控虚拟机的运行状态和存储健康情况,设置报警机制
- 快照管理:定期创建虚拟机快照,作为即时恢复点,但需注意快照过多会影响性能,应定期清理无用快照
- 灾难恢复计划:制定详细的灾难恢复计划,包括虚拟机删除后的应急响应流程、恢复步骤和资源调配
四、虚拟机删除后的恢复策略 一旦虚拟机被删除,迅速启动恢复流程至关重要
以下是几种常见的恢复策略: 1. 从备份恢复 最可靠且常见的方法是从最近的备份中恢复虚拟机
步骤通常包括: - 确认备份:首先验证备份的完整性和可用性,确保备份数据未受损
- 选择恢复点:根据业务需求和数据重要性,选择合适的恢复点
- 执行恢复:使用备份软件按照向导操作,将虚拟机恢复到原位置或新位置
- 验证恢复:恢复完成后,启动虚拟机并验证其功能和数据完整性
2. 利用快照恢复 如果虚拟机在删除前有可用的快照,可以直接从快照恢复: - 登录vSphere客户端:使用vSphere Web Client或vSphere Client登录到vCenter Server
- 定位虚拟机:在虚拟机清单中找到被删除的虚拟机(通常显示为已删除状态)
- 选择快照:在虚拟机摘要页面中,找到快照选项卡,选择需要恢复的快照
- 执行恢复:点击“恢复到此快照”,按照提示完成恢复过程
注意:快照恢复适用于近期删除且快照未被清理的情况
频繁使用快照会影响存储性能和空间利用率,因此应谨慎管理
3. 从存储中恢复 在某些情况下,虚拟机文件可能并未完全从存储中删除,而是被标记为删除或隐藏
此时,可以尝试使用数据恢复软件扫描存储介质,寻找并恢复虚拟机文件
这种方法风险较高,因为不当操作可能导致数据进一步损坏
建议寻求专业数据恢复服务的帮助
4. 从vCenter Server回收站恢复(如适用) 在某些版本的vCenter Server中,提供了虚拟机回收站功能,允许在一定时间内恢复已删除的虚拟机
操作步骤简述如下: - 登录vCenter Server:使用vSphere Client登录到vCenter Server
- 访问回收站:在vCenter Server主页或虚拟机清单中,找到并访问回收站
选择虚拟机:在回收站中,找到要恢复的虚拟机
- 执行恢复:点击“恢复”按钮,按照提示将虚拟机恢复到指定位置
注意:并非所有版本的vCenter Server都支持回收站功能,且恢复时间有限制
五、恢复后的验证与优化 虚拟机恢复后,并不意味着任务结束
还需要进行一系列验证和优化工作,确保虚拟机稳定运行并满足业务需求: - 功能验证:启动虚拟机,检查所有服务是否正常运行,应用和数据是否完整
- 性能测试:运行性能测试,确保虚拟机性能恢复到删除前的水平
- 安全扫描:对虚拟机进行安全扫描,确保没有恶意软件残留
- 配置优化:根据当前环境和业务需求,调整虚拟机的资源配置(如CPU、内存、存储)
- 文档更新:更新灾难恢复计划和相关文档,记录本次恢复的经验教训和改进措施
六、结论 VMware虚拟机删除恢复是一项复杂而关键的任务,它不仅考验着技术人员的专业技能,更考验着企业的数据管理和灾难恢复能力
通过实施有效的预防措施、制定合理的恢复策略以及恢复后的验证与优化,可以最大限度地减少虚拟机删除带来的损失,保障业务连续性和数据安全
在面对虚拟机删除的挑战时,保持冷静、迅速行动并借助专业工具和服务的支持,将是成功恢复的关键